At its core, calculus involves the study of rates of change and accumulation. Derivatives, a fundamental concept in calculus, measure how functions change as their input changes. Think of it like this: imagine you're driving a car, and you want to know your speed at any given moment. A derivative would give you that exact information. Integrals, on the other hand, represent the accumulation of a quantity over a defined interval. Think of it like filling a bucket with water – the integral would tell you how much water is in the bucket after a certain amount of time.
